OIM uses the RSA Admin SDK for the 'connector', so you could download the RSA Authentication Manager Admin SDK for your version and look at the documentation which would show everything possible across a 'connector'.
If your are on 8.2, the admin sdk is found on the rsa-am-extras .iso download. Follow the instructions here on000034558 - How to download RSA Authentication Manager 8.x full kits from RSA Link.
